Pho.to Alternatives

Pho.to is described as 'Improve and play with your digital pictures at Pho.to site with easy yet powerful editing tools and services. Enhance your pictures, have fun with your photos online, retouch portraits and share your photos for free. Free Pho.to services:' and is a Image Editor in the photos & graphics category. There are more than 100 alternatives to Pho.to for a variety of platforms, including Windows, Mac, iPhone, Web-based and Android apps. The best Pho.to alternative is GIMP, which is both free and Open Source. Other great apps like Pho.to are Adobe Photoshop, Paint.NET, Pixlr and Photoscape.

  5. CinePaint icon
     15 likes
    Copy a direct link to this comment to your clipboard

    CinePaint is a deep paint application that edits EXR, DPX, 16-bit TIFF, JPEG, PNG and many other types of image files. CinePaint is available as a native application for Linux, Mac OS X, and BSD.

  9. Gpaint icon
     10 likes
    Copy a direct link to this comment to your clipboard

    gpaint (aka GNU Paint), a small-scale painting program for GNOME, the GNU Desktop Environment. gpaint does not attempt to compete with GIMP, it is just a simple drawing package based on xpaint, along the lines of Microsoft Paint.
